ESRISourceReader: Account for `null` values for "accessInformation"

Signed-off-by: Taylor Smock <tsmock@fb.com>
pull/1/head v1.9.15
Taylor Smock 2022-06-28 12:40:44 -06:00
rodzic 840cadb61b
commit 48751b16ec
Nie znaleziono w bazie danych klucza dla tego podpisu
ID klucza GPG: 625F6A74A3E4311A
1 zmienionych plików z 2 dodań i 1 usunięć

Wyświetl plik

@ -181,7 +181,8 @@ public class ESRISourceReader {
if (this.ignoreConflationCategories.contains(newInfo.getCategory())) {
newInfo.setConflation(false);
}
if (feature.containsKey("accessInformation")) {
if (feature.containsKey("accessInformation")
&& feature.get("accessInformation").getValueType() != JsonValue.ValueType.NULL) {
newInfo.setAttributionText(feature.getString("accessInformation"));
}
newInfo.setDescription(feature.getString("snippet"));